A 19th-century pastel in the Louis XVI style depicting an elegant young woman in a bust portrait, turned slightly three-quarters, wearing a costume inspired by the late 18th century. The figure is distinguished by a gentle expression, an updo adorned with colorful feathers, and a wide blue bow at the bodice, elements that lend the whole a theatrical and highly decorative grace. The muted background and the soft modeling of the face highlight the delicacy of the drawing and the powdery quality of the technique. This portrait reflects the Louis XVI style, with a later interpretation typical of the 19th century, leaning more towards elegant and decorative evocation than strict period portraiture. The composition recalls fanciful female portraits inspired by 18th-century France, with a quest for charm, delicacy, and worldly allure. The pastel retains a beautiful softness of execution and a very pleasing presence as a decorative piece. The work is presented under glass in a rectangular wooden frame, likely replaced or reattached at a later date. There are signs of age, some minor wear consistent with use, and visible dust and impurities behind the glass. The frame also shows signs of age. Overall, it is in good decorative condition.
